The Memoirs of the AMS is devoted to the publication of new research in all areas of pure and applied mathematics. The Memoirs is designed particularly to publish long papers of groups of cognate papers in book form, and is under the supervision of the Editorial Committee of the AMS journal Transactions of the American Mathematical Society. All papers are peer-reviewed.

Chapters 1. Introduction 2. Invariant dynamics for Hartree SdNLW 3. Notations and basic lemmas 4. On the stochastic terms 5. Construction of the Gibbs measures 6. Further analysis in the defocusing case: $0 < \beta \leq 1$ 7. Paracontrolled operators 8. Local well-posedness of Hartree SdNLW 9. Invariant Gibbs dynamics A. On the parabolic stochastic quantization of the focusing Hartree Gibbs measure B. On the regularities of the stochastic terms C. Absolute continuity with respectto the shifted measure
